码迷,mamicode.com
首页 > 其他好文 > 详细

报错之-Cannot set property 'onclick' of null

时间:2016-09-02 17:22:33      阅读:3892      评论:0      收藏:0      [点我收藏+]

标签:

当js文件放在head里面时,如果绑定了onclick或者onmouseover事件,就会出现如下图类似的错误,是因为浏览器的加载你写的html文档的顺序是从上往下,加载完按钮节点才执行的js,所以当浏览器自顶向下解析时,找不到onclick绑定的按钮节点,于是报错。解决办法有:第一,把js文件放在底部加载;第二,使用window.onload=function(){}包裹js内容。

技术分享

报错之-Cannot set property 'onclick' of null

标签:

原文地址:http://www.cnblogs.com/qiutianlidehanxing-blog/p/5834184.html

(2)
(1)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!